Art Deco Flair
9.5 x 14.5 cm plate
17 x 21 mm images


In case you can't tell, Art Deco Flair is UberChic's second plate inspired by the Roaring Twenties.  I'll admit, it's hard for me to see any color combination other than black and gold when I look at these images, thanks to The Great Gatsby.  But I did mix it up a bit more and used a few other colors.  But seriously, wouldn't they all look amazing in black and gold?!  


Base: Girly Bits Gettin Figgy With It
Stamping: Mundo de Unas Bronze stamped over A England Camelot (on the UberMat) and cut into strips and applied as decals 
Top coat: Glisten & Glow 



Base: Sinful Colors Snow Me White
Stamping: Mundo de Unas Black
Leadlighting with Essie Muse Myself, Art New-Beau, Blush Stroke and Highest Bidder
Top coat: Glisten & Glow



Base: Painted Polish Stamped In Moss and Hit The Bottle On The Loose With Chartreuse
Stamping: same as above but reversed
Top coat: Glisten & Glow matte top coat
